Camp Whitewood
Arts/Crafts Instructor
Job
Description
I. Qualifications
- Must be at least
18 years old.
- Must possess
experience in a variety
of arts and crafts.
- Should be
experienced in teaching
and working with young people for extended periods of time.
II. Responsibilities
- Directly
responsible to the Program
Director/Coordinator.
- Must meet with
the Program Director/
Coordinator prior to camping season to become familiar with crafts
being
offered and to begin preparing lesson plans.
- Should take
initiative to share
creative ideas with the Program Director/Coordinator.
- Prepare short
directions on each
craft to use as reference for teaching by staff and counselors.
- Have a variety
of completed samples
of each craft made up on display at the beginning of each camp.
- Be at Lodge 15
minutes or more
(as needed) before craft instruction periods to have tools, supplies
and
work area ready for activities.
- Responsible for
keeping daily inventories of all crafts supplies, equipment, and need
for supplies or equipment.
- Maintain crafts
store, crafts hall,
all crafts tools and supplies in a clean and orderly working
condition.
- These statements
on duties are
not to be taken as the final and only work to be done by staff members.
Frequently it is necessary for individual staff members to cooperate on
a project, which
is important for the continued smooth operation of the camp. Such
duties
will be under the direction of the Camp Executive Director.
III. All Staff and Directors
- Set an example
by conducting themselves in a proper manner.
- Observe a habit
of cleanliness
of self and quarters.
- Be present
promptly at meal times.
- Participate in
camp activities
when possible.
- There shall be
no alcoholic beverages on Camp Whitewood grounds at anytime.
- Staff Certified
in C.P. R. may
have to administer resuscitation by means of a mechanical airway.
- Complete a
written evaluation and
final inventory at the end of camping season.
